导师介绍:
Yi-Kuen Lee,(李贻昆),Ph.D.– June 2001, Mechanical Engineering, University of California, Los Angeles, USA(major in MEMS); PhD thesis supervisor: Prof Chin-Ming Ho, a member of US National Academy of Engineering (www.nae.edu)
研究领域:
- Bio-MEMS/NEMS: micro electroporation cell chip for DNA transfection and drug delivery,micro/nano electrophoresis chip, micro electroendocytosis cell chip;
- Micro/nano bubble actuators and inkjet for biosensor and integrated microfluidic systems;
- Fluorescence Microscopy for single DNA molecules dynamics in microfluidics;
- Microfluidics using Giant Electrorheological Fluid (GER fluid) & other smart nanomaterials;
- Microfluidics using Giant Electrorheological Fluid (GER fluid) & other smart nanomaterials;
- Micro/nanofabrication key technologies: Deep RIE for silicon.
- Superhydrophobic nanoflower surfaces using Deep RIE and PECVD for carbon nanotubes;
- Wireless micro motion sensors for healthcare of elderly people;
- Micro/nano resonators/oscillators for timing of electronics and biosensing.

RESEARCH HONORS AND AWARDS
• Micro mixing by electroosmotic flow in microchannels with surface charge patterning(Paper a.5: J. Micromech. Microeng. 14(2), 247–255, 2004) was reported by MIT Technology Review magazine on 17 May 2004 (http://www.techreview.com).
• The ultra-high-aspect-ratio submicron pillar array fabricated without e-beam lithography (Paper a.18: J. Micromech. Microeng. 16(4), 699–707, 2006) was reported by the leading DRIE company, STS’s Innovations Newsletter, July 2006(http://www.stsystems.com).
• The refereed conference paper entitled "Nonlinear Transmembrane Current
Response of Micro Electroporation for Human Cancer Cells," by H. He, D.C. Chang
and Y.K. Lee, was selected as one of the 10 finalist for Best Paper Award in IEEE
NEMS, Bangkok, Thailand, Jan 16-19, 2007.
• The refereed conference paper, “Battery-powered miniaturized electroporation system,” by H. He, D.C. Chang and Y.-K. Lee was elected as the one of the 10 Best Paper Finalists in IEEE NEMS 2009, Shenzhen, Jan 5-8, 2009.
